Structure Characteristics
1.Monobloc structrure——no any external leakage
Sealing face is located on the sealing ring not onthe valve body, thus ensuring machining precision of the sealing face, without any leaking point, true zero leakage valves
2.Streamlined Channel Design——saving for energy, environmental protection
Both valve housing and body cavity are streamlined such that full and consistent medium flow can be attained, with low pressure loss, stable flow pattern,no cavitation and low noise.
3.Unique Disc Shaft Design——No obstruction, reliable Operation
Special design for the front and rear bearings and the discshaft avoids obstruction which often occurs in the use of similarvalves, and keeps stable 'open' and 'close' operations. Meanwhile,the poor alignment of disc resulted from factor of gravity and leakagein sealing face caused by unequal loading between sealing face and disc can also be avoided.
4.Precise Spring Design——Starting and sealing at low Pressure
When disc is in closed position, spring thrust is slightly greater than the sum of disc gravity and friction between disc and the front and rear bearings. Disc can return to the seat either at low
pressure or in any installation position. And valves can be opened at low pressure, opening load is reduced and safe operation of pumps is ensured.
